Sports analysts have noted that the 2026 State of Origin decider not only broke broadcast records but also demonstrated the evolving dynamics of rugby league viewership and engagement. The impressive tally of 18 points by Nathan Cleary set a new standard for individual performance in a high-stakes game.

The controversial try awarded to Bradman Best sparked discussions on officiating and the role of video technology in modern sport, exemplifying the balance between human judgment and technological assistance.

Looking ahead, experts anticipate that the State of Origin series will continue to expand its reach, leveraging media partnerships and digital platforms to enhance fan experience. The 2027 series preparations reflect this momentum, aiming to maintain high competition levels while growing the audience.

Overall, the match underscored the significance of the State of Origin series as a cultural and sporting phenomenon, influencing the future direction of rugby league in Australia.
